Your Tasks
- Assess current data management practices, identify gaps, and help develop an updated, DFG-compliant data governance strategy.
- Contribute to the development and maintenance of the consortium’s data management workflows, including open-source software development where needed.
- Ensure smooth operation of all workflow components, including SODAR (web GUI, REST API, CLI tools) and its underlying systems (iRODS, ISA metadata model).
- Manage data transfer and access within the consortium, including authorization and permissions.
- Ensure metadata and data quality (accuracy, completeness, consistency).
- Maintain a library of sample sheet templates using controlled vocabularies and ontologies, in collaboration with researchers.
- Maintain DFG-compliant SOPs and coordinate training and guidance for researchers.
- Master’s degree (or Bachelor’s + ≥5 years experience) in Bioinformatics, Computational Biology, Computer Science, Engineering, or a related field.
- Working knowledge of modern OMICS datasets and the FAIR principles.
- Experience with data governance, research data management, and compliance.
- Hands-on experience with large-scale scientific data, metadata handling, Unix-like environments, and programming (preferably Python); database skills are a plus.
- Ability to work with and extend an existing code base (Git or similar).
- Understanding of research culture, scientific information management, and Open Science standards.
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ills; German language skills are an advantage.
